I believe that Go Westy or perhaps I read it on the Samba that one of the biggest problems with upper control arm bushings is poor installation procedures.

Here's Go Westy's article: http://www.gowesty.com/library_article.php?id=1144

Here's the one from the Samba: http://www.thesamba.com/vw/forum/viewtopic.php?t=272333

There's some good information here for anyone interested.

I actually thought about using some JB Weld instead of having them spot welded, as overheating them seems to be a big problem. I need to change mine out this summer.
